From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.



在运行过程中如何同时显示多个子VI的前面板?



主要软件:
主要软件版本: 7.1
主要软件修正版本: N/A
次要软件: N/A

问题:
我在一个顶层VI中调用了一些子VI。我希望一旦调用顶层VI,所有子VI的前面板就能同时平铺式地出现,是否能实现?


解答:
您能很容易地以这种方式打开子VI。请运行附件中的范例程序来查看是否满足您需求的功能。该范例是一个LLB,其中顶层VI名为MAIN.vi,运行MAIN.vi可实现您期望的功能。为了指定每个子VI的屏幕大小和位置,请打开每个子VI设置并重新设置前面板为期望的大小。然后,将子VI的前面板移动到合适的位置。最后, 右击子VI的图标并选择VI属性。然后,选择窗口外观菜单并单击自定义。确保调用时显示前面板选项被勾选。最后,选择窗口大小菜单并单击设置为当前前面板大小按钮。对其他希望平铺在屏幕不同区域的子VI也做同样的操作并在结束时存储所有子VI。


相关链接: KnowledgeBase 19688DKD: How Can I Use the Position Properties to Position A Front Panel Object in LabVIEW?
KnowledgeBase 1XHGS1HE: Can a LabVIEW VI Run in the Background Without a Front Panel?

附件:


DisplaySubVIs.llb - DisplaySubVIs.llb


报告日期: 08/09/2004
最近更新: 12/08/2008
文档编号: 3C891HZH